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ky roof or malfunctioning HVAC system.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to costly repairs and even collapse.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the stain and develop a plan to address it.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ove water and dry the area, preventing further damage.

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ration Cost in Golden Gate, FL

The cost of Ceiling Drywall Water Damage Restoration in Golden Gate, FL, can vary depending on the severity and extent of the damage.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an to address your needs and budget. Our goal is to make this process as stress-free as possible for you.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water involved.
Ceiling reconstruction and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required for reconstruction.
Insurance claims process $0 – $500 The complexity of the claims process and the amount of documentation required.
